A fixed twelve-week arc for companies that need momentum — from mapping a consultative sales flow to a live product your team can run.
Two weeks with your team. We map the sales flow, write the brief, draw the edges, cut the rest. You leave with a plan you could hand to anyone.
Eight weeks of heads-down making. A single standing review each Friday; otherwise, we build. The work is visible every day.
Two weeks to launch, measure, and hand it off. You get the codebase, the system, the story — and a team that knows it cold.
